Remember the cool Groovi poetry plates? Well, I decided they would make super stamps, too. And they certainly do! In fact, I just had to try them out! Check these out!

So she reached for a scrap, and using the new indexing sheet that the stamps come on, she decided where to stamp

She could have stamped both the verse and the frame together, but wanted to flag up that they’re separate stamps. Black Archival ink, because the scrap was acrylic paint, and she needed a permanent ink pad.

Words next. Pressed too hard, so the “difference” came out too thick. But hey!
Not important, is it? Looks like an old typewriter!
Colour next. She used what she had on the table: Polychromos.
Pergaliners would do the job admirably too…
Substantial price difference.
The Perga Liners are super when you’re starting out with parchment and colouring.
The Polychromos by Faber Castell are the next step.
She cut a frame using a Fresh Cut nested square out of a 7×7 black cardblank, trimmed the scrap, then wished she hadn’t! Would have been much easier to position if she hadn’t…
But it all came out fine in the end.
It usually does….

And as the Serenity Prayer tells us, if you can’t change it, get over it. If you can change it, then do. It’s that little word in the middle: Acceptance.
